Publisher's Synopsis

Sinatra's Tailor is the remarkable story of Umberto Autore, orphaned as a young boy in Italy during WWII and raised by "nuns and Nazis". He eventually immigrated to America where he became the tailor of first Frank Sinatra and then Steven Spielberg.
